8 Indications of a Sewer Line Blockage

Wastewater is a health hazard that must be addressed by a specialist. Your drain line may be clogged if a nasty smell originates from the sink, bathroom, tub or shower. That nasty odor is sewage that drains badly as a result of clogs.

Clogs can cause family drains to stop working considering that they are connected to the sewage-disposal tank or community sewer system. The water degrees in the toilet change when the drains pipes don't work effectively or the bathroom won't flush. Drains that are linked can gurgle as soon as you flush the bathroom.

Constant Clogs-- If you observe that commodes, bathroom and kitchen sinks, and also tubs or showers in your home often stop working to drain without using a plunger or a chemical drain cleaner, you may have a primary sewage system line clog. Don't neglect this trouble-- specifically if you have to utilize a bettor or chemical drain cleaner each time you flush or utilize the sink.

Slow Drains-- A clear indication of sewer blockage is when you see that numerous of your drains have actually reduced at the very same time. If you presume a drain obstruction check all your low lying components. These consist of the commode, the bath tub, as well as the bathroom. If a lot of them are sluggish or not draining pipes whatsoever, after that you have a trouble.

Bad Smells-- When your main sewage system drainpipe and lines are obstructed, wastewater comes back into your sinks, commodes, as well as bathtubs. Although you may not see the water promptly after the clog starts, you will see a negative scent. That is a sign that unclean water is seeping back into the drain pipelines or otherwise draining pipes in all.

Numerous Fixtures Included-- Flushing the toilet just to have your bathtub full of water, or running your cleaning equipment and also your toilet overruns probably means you have a clog someplace.

Unusual Sounds-- Does your commode make a gurgling sound after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you turn off the shower, do you listen to squeaking sounds or various other strange sounds originating from the wall surfaces or via the floors? If so, you may have a clog in among the drain pipes.

Fluctuating Water Level In The Commode-- You possibly have a trouble with your primary sewage system drainpipe lines if the water in your commode rises and falls for no factor. Examine whether the water level is affected by draining your tub or kitchen area sink. If that is happening, you require to have your drain lines examined.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ipeline that plumbers use to unclog drain lines. If you notice water draining of it, you have a sewer drain blockage. Apart from being unhygienic, the water can make your backyard odor very bad.

Exterior Issues-- Check the outside of your home for water pools (specifically if it hasn't drizzled in a while), poor odors, yellow as well as brownish spots on your yard, or subjected tree roots that appear too close to your home. These issues usually suggest a primary sewage system line blockage.

There are a range of reasons that sewer lines obtain obstructed. Unclogging them on your own can make the issue worse, so it is always advisable to speak to an expert pipes specialist. He or she can inspect the system, tidy, as well as inform you what caused the obstruction. Right here some feasible root causes of a sewer blockage.

Serious Pipe Damages-- When the sewage system pipe is broken or harmed, the drain line will certainly not drain appropriately. Sewage system pipelines can burst when there is enhanced website traffic above ground or using heavy building devices. Keep in mind that when steel pipes damage as a result of rust, they do not drain pipes appropriately.

Drooping Sewer Lines-- Dirt modifications can cause your drain line to sag. When this happens, the section that has sunk gathers paper as well as waste resulting in a blockage.

Root Seepage-- If you have older major sewage system drain and also lines made of porous materials like clay, trees, and hedges origins, latch onto them. As they expand as well as the origins get bigger, they can damage the drain pipeline and also cause an obstruction.

Flushing Debris Down The Bathroom-- There are several things that you can not flush down the commode. When you flush face cells, eggshells, coffee grounds, toilet scrub pads, as well as tampons down the commode, it will certainly clog your sewage system line.

Ways to stop Future Sewage System Line Clogs

Avoid future obstructions by preserving tidy sewer lines. Avoid purging womanly hygiene items, face cleansing cloths, thick paper towels or toilet tissue, and various other products not meant for flushing down the bathroom.

Think about removing older trees near to your house or septic tank to avoid tree roots from damaging sewage system lines. Tree origins can additionally create primary sewer line blockages by infiltrating sewer lines as well as blocking water flow to the septic system. Tree origins can trigger toilet tissue as well as strong waste to build up and also cause clogs.

Use Enzyme Cleaning Company Month-to-month-- To prevent your sewer lines from blocking, tidy them once a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have harsh chemicals as well as are safe for you as well as your family members. That kept in mind, make sure that you have your drain lines checked by a specialist plumbing professional regularly.

Keep Plant Kingdom From The Drain Lines-- Plants' roots can influence your sewage system line, so do not plant trees, blossoms, or bushes. These plants make maintenance hard as well as also can harm the pipelines.

Utilize the wastebasket-- The only thing that ought to be flushed down the bathroom is human waste and water. Hygiene products such as sanitary pads and also tampons can severely obstruct your sewage system line.

Replace Old Clay Water Lines-- If you live in an older home with lead or clay sewage system pipes, think about changing them. It will secure you from a sewer drain clog. The best plumber can quickly replace your sewage system pipelines, and ensure that your system is functioning.
